The Mandate for Precision Execution

Executing substantial capital allocations in the digital asset space presents a distinct set of challenges. The public order books of centralized and decentralized exchanges, while suitable for retail-sized transactions, become adversarial environments for six-figure trades. Large market orders broadcast intent to the entire market, inviting front-running and creating slippage that erodes the entry or exit price. During volatile periods, this price slippage can escalate to several percentage points, transforming a well-conceived strategy into an unprofitable execution.

This phenomenon, known as price impact, is a direct function of a trade’s size relative to the available liquidity. For the serious investor, controlling this variable is a primary determinant of success.

A Request for Quote (RFQ) system provides a professional-grade solution engineered to bypass these public market frictions. It is a private negotiation mechanism where a trader can discreetly solicit competitive bids for a large block of assets from a network of institutional liquidity providers and market makers. This process occurs off the main exchange order book, ensuring the trade’s size and intent remain confidential until after execution.

The core function of an RFQ is to source deep, institutional liquidity on demand, allowing for the execution of a single, large transaction at a pre-agreed price. This method effectively neutralizes the risk of slippage and negative market impact that plagues large orders on public venues.

The operational flow is direct and powerful. An investor initiates an RFQ, specifying the asset, quantity, and desired side of the trade (buy or sell). This request is broadcast privately to a curated group of dealers who compete to offer the best price. The initiator then selects the most favorable quote and executes the trade.

The entire process, from request to settlement, is designed for certainty and efficiency. It transforms the act of trading from a passive hope for a good fill into a proactive process of price discovery and command. This mechanism is particularly vital for complex, multi-leg options strategies, where the simultaneous execution of all parts at a specific net price is fundamental to the strategy’s integrity.

Calibrated Strategies for Capital Deployment

Deploying capital through an RFQ system moves beyond theoretical advantages and into the realm of concrete, repeatable strategies that generate a quantifiable edge. The primary application is the execution of large spot positions in assets like Bitcoin (BTC) and Ethereum (ETH) with minimal market disturbance. The objective is to acquire or liquidate a significant holding without signaling your activity to the broader market, thereby preserving your intended price level. An investor looking to deploy $500,000 into BTC can use an RFQ to get firm quotes from multiple dealers, locking in a single transaction price for the entire amount, a stark contrast to the potential for severe slippage when placing such an order on a public exchange.

In highly volatile crypto markets, slippage rates can surge above 5% during major market events, a cost that RFQ systems are specifically designed to mitigate.

The true power of this execution method becomes apparent when applied to the nuanced world of derivatives. Sophisticated options strategies, which are the cornerstone of institutional risk management and alpha generation, depend entirely on precise execution. A multi-leg options structure, such as a protective collar or an iron condor, requires that all its components be bought and sold simultaneously to establish the desired risk profile at a specific net cost.

Attempting to “leg into” such a position on a public market is fraught with peril; price movements between the execution of each leg can invalidate the entire strategy. RFQ systems solve this by treating the entire multi-leg structure as a single, indivisible package, allowing dealers to quote on the complete strategy.

Executing a Protective Options Collar

A common institutional strategy is the protective collar, used to hedge a large underlying holding against downside risk while financing the hedge by selling away some upside potential. An investor holding a substantial amount of ETH can use this strategy to secure their portfolio. The structure involves holding the underlying asset, buying a protective put option, and selling a call option. The premium received from selling the call helps to offset the cost of buying the put.

Using an RFQ system is the superior method for establishing this position for several reasons:

  • Guaranteed Net Price: The investor can request a quote for the entire collar structure. Dealers will bid on the net debit or credit of the combined options legs, ensuring the investor knows the exact cost of the hedge before execution.
  • Zero Legging Risk: The entire three-part position (long ETH, long put, short call) is executed in a single, atomic transaction. There is no risk of the market moving after buying the put but before selling the call, which could dramatically alter the cost and effectiveness of the hedge.
  • Access to Specialized Liquidity: Options market makers specialize in pricing complex structures and managing the associated risks (like volatility and delta). An RFQ connects the investor directly to this specialized liquidity pool, leading to more competitive pricing than what is typically available on retail-facing exchanges.

A Framework for RFQ Collar Execution

An investor holding 100 ETH, currently trading at $3,500 per ETH, wishes to protect against a drop below $3,200 over the next three months, while being willing to cap their potential profit at $4,000.

  1. Strategy Formulation: The investor decides to implement a “zero-cost” collar. The goal is to select strike prices for the put and call options where the premium received from the sold call entirely covers the premium paid for the purchased put.
  2. RFQ Initiation: The investor constructs a single RFQ request for the entire package ▴ Buy 100 ETH Put options with a $3,200 strike and simultaneously Sell 100 ETH Call options with a $4,000 strike, both with the same three-month expiration.
  3. Competitive Bidding: Multiple institutional options desks receive the request. They compete to offer the best net price for the package. One dealer might offer a net credit of $5 per ETH, while another offers a net credit of $7.
  4. Execution: The investor accepts the most favorable quote. The entire two-legged options structure is executed instantly at the agreed-upon net price. The investor has now successfully hedged a $350,000 position with precision, establishing a defined range of outcomes for their portfolio over the next quarter.

Trading Volatility with Straddles and Strangles

Beyond hedging, RFQ systems are indispensable for speculative strategies focused on market volatility. A long straddle (buying a call and a put at the same strike price) or a strangle (buying a call and a put at different strike prices) are bets on a large price movement in either direction. These are pure volatility plays. Executing these two-legged strategies via RFQ is critical because their profitability is highly sensitive to the initial cost basis.

An RFQ ensures the trader can lock in the tightest possible spread between the two options, directly improving the strategy’s potential return on investment. It allows traders to take a view on market turbulence itself, with the certainty that their entry price is fixed and optimized through a competitive bidding process.

Systemic Integration for Portfolio Alpha

Mastering RFQ execution is the foundational skill; integrating it as a systemic component of portfolio management is where durable alpha is generated. The applications extend far beyond single-trade execution into the programmatic management of a large-scale digital asset portfolio. Consider the task of portfolio rebalancing. For a fund or individual with a target allocation of 60% BTC and 40% ETH, market movements will cause these weights to drift.

Periodically, the portfolio must be rebalanced, which involves selling the outperforming asset and buying the underperforming one. Executing these large rebalancing trades on the open market would create significant price impact, effectively penalizing the portfolio for its own success. Using an RFQ system allows for these large blocks to be traded discreetly at firm prices, preserving returns and maintaining strict adherence to the target allocation strategy with minimal friction.

This same principle applies to more dynamic strategies. Quantitative funds that rely on algorithmic signals to shift allocations between assets can use RFQ platforms as their primary execution venue. When a model dictates a large rotation from one asset to another, the trade can be executed as a single block transaction through a competitive quote process. This decouples the signal generation from the execution risk.

Advanced Risk Management and Yield Generation

For sophisticated portfolios, options overlays are a powerful tool for shaping returns and managing risk. An investor can systematically sell out-of-the-money covered calls against a large Bitcoin holding to generate a consistent stream of income. While this can be done on public exchanges, managing the weekly or monthly rolling of these positions across a seven-figure portfolio becomes operationally complex and subject to slippage. An RFQ system streamlines this entire process.

A portfolio manager can request quotes to roll a large, expiring short-call position to a new strike price and expiration date in a single transaction. This ensures the hedge or yield-generation strategy remains continuously active without gaps in coverage or adverse price movements during execution.

Furthermore, the ability to source liquidity for complex, multi-leg options structures opens up a new universe of risk management possibilities. A portfolio manager might want to hedge against a sudden spike in market-wide volatility (a “vega” risk). They could construct a calendar spread or a ratio spread designed to profit from such an event.

These structures are often too complex and illiquid to execute efficiently on standard exchanges. An RFQ connects the portfolio manager with specialized derivatives desks that can price and provide liquidity for these bespoke risk management instruments, effectively allowing the manager to build a financial firewall tailored to their specific portfolio exposures.

The Strategic Choice in Market Microstructure

The decision to use an RFQ is a deliberate choice about how to engage with the market’s microstructure. Public order books offer transparency and speed for small sizes but come with the cost of price impact for large trades. An RFQ offers price certainty and minimal impact at the potential expense of the instantaneous execution one might find on a central limit order book. A sophisticated trader understands this is not a binary choice of one being universally better, but a strategic decision based on objectives and market conditions.

For a high-frequency strategy that profits from microsecond advantages, the public order book is the natural habitat. For an institutional-scale strategy where the primary goal is to deploy or repatriate significant capital at the best possible price without disrupting the market, the RFQ is the superior tool. True mastery lies in understanding which tool to use for which job, and recognizing that for trades of consequence, the private, competitive negotiation of an RFQ provides a level of control and certainty that the public market cannot match.
